How does San Nicolas West compare to other barangays in Agoo?
Within Agoo, barangay-level differences are primarily driven by: (1) distance from the city center — closer barangays command higher prices and better transport access; (2) elevation and flood history — higher barangays are generally safer; (3) proximity to schools and markets — a practical factor for families. Compare specific properties rather than barangay names for the most accurate evaluation.
Is it better to buy in San Nicolas West or in Agoo proper?
"Agoo proper" typically refers to the Poblacion or central barangays — denser, pricier, but closer to amenities and transport. San Nicolas West may offer more space for the same budget, at the cost of a longer commute to commercial areas. The right choice depends on your lifestyle priorities: proximity vs. space and affordability.
